<p>Yeah, I&#8217;d call that a choke. The Saskatchewan Roughriders blew a 27-11 fourth quarter lead, falling to the Montreal Alouettes 28-27 in tonight&#8217;s Grey Cup on a 33-yard Damon Duval field goal as time expired. I&#8217;m guessing this one&#8217;s a little hard to take for Regina natives, because from what I understand, the CFL is pretty much their lives.</p>
<p>In the end, the team that was by far the most dominant in the league this year came out on top. Sure, they got some help from an inept Rider squad late, but that&#8217;s why they play the full 60 minutes. Avon Cobourne, whose three-yard score midway through the fourth pulled Montreal within eight, picked up MVP honours. I&#8217;ll check back in with more on this one tomorrow.</p>

<p>The 2009 CFL Grey Cup will feature the Montreal Alouettes and the Saskatchewan Roughriders . Montreal (15-3) and Saskatchewan (10-7-1) will be meeting for the first time in the Grey Cup as both teams  finished atop there respective divisions this year which earned both teams a first round bye in the playoffs. The Als and Riders then took advantage of home field in their respective Conference Final games.</p>
</div>
<p>The East Final was a rout in the Als&#8217; favour, as they continued to show their dominance this year with a 56-18 thumping at the expense of the B.C. Lions. Anthony Calvillo was lights out, as he threw for five touchdowns in the game, which ties his career-high mark.  In front of a sold-out crowd at Olympic Stadium, the win was never at risk for the Als as they took advantage of a Lions team that looked sluggish and didn&#8217;t seemed to have a chance of winning.</p>
<p><!--more--></p>
<p>The Saskatchewan Roughriders&#8217; 27-17 win over the Stampeders wasn&#8217;t as easy. The Stampeders, looking to win there 2nd consecutive Grey Cup took an early 10-0 lead but could not match the Riders momentum after they got on the board. Saskatchewan QB Darian Durant threw for 204 yards and three touchdowns as he started to take control of the game. It was the first West Final hosted by Saskatchewan since 1976 and they made sure the home town fans had something to cheer about.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">The Als will be making their 7th appearance in the Grey Cup this decade while only having one Grey Cup to show for it, that coming in 2002. The Riders will be making there 2nd appearance in three years at the Grey Cup. The Als head into the Grey Cup as heavy favourties after posting the best record, best offense, and best defence in the league. To add insult to injury, the Als went 2-0 vs the Riders this season.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">That being said, with this just being a one game playoff anything can happen. We&#8217;ve seen some great Grey Cups over the years and expect another this year. The Als have been too good all year to let this season get away and I expect them to win 27-24. All you bookies can start making your spreads.</p>

<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><p>Austria&#8217;s anti-doping agency ban Pfannberger after EPO positive  <strong>Christian Pfannberger</strong> has been given a life-long ban by the Austrian National Anti-Doping Agency, after his second doping violation in March this year. The Austrian, who has consistently denied ever having doped, has indicated he will challenge the ban. <strong> Pfannberger</strong>, 30, tested positive for EPO at an out-of-competition control in March. He had previously served a two-year ban from 2004 to 2006 after testing positive for testosterone.  “This is what we expected, since he has been caught twice,” <strong>Herbert Koche</strong>r, Vice President of the Austrian cycling federation (Österreichischen Radsportverband, ÖRV) told Cyclingnews. “We are a federation that fights against doping with our full force and are therefore satisfied with the results.”  Pfannberger turned pro in 2002 with the German Team <strong>Nürnberger Versicherung </strong>and rode for <strong>Team Volksbank Ideal </strong>in 2003. His first violation came in 2004 when he was riding for the Czech team eD System-ZVVZ. When he returned, he rode for the Austrian team <strong>Elk Haus-Simplon</strong> (2006-2007), <strong>Barloworld</strong> (2008) and <strong>Katusha </strong>(2009).  The Austrian was Military world champion in the road race in 1999, and won the Under-23 International Thüringen Rundfahrt in 2001. As a pro, he won both the Austrian national road title (2007, 2008) and the mountain title (2006). He finished 23rd in the road race at the 2008 Beijing Olympics.</p>

<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><p>1. It is too risky. Yes, there&#8217;s sincere gamble associated with pedalling. Riders do collide and get bashed by vehicles. But how parlous is biking in comparison with other forms of transit and with our understanding of the hazard? A lot less than you might reckon.</p>
<p>Think on the calculations of a company that undertakes safety and failure testing, once called the Failure Group and now called Exponent. The company reviewed a range of past-times and determined that the number of fatal accidents per 1million hrs of exposure was 0.26 for biking, 0.47 for driving, 1.53 for living (all causes of death), and 8.80 for motorcycling. To put it another way, they discovered that the hazards of biking were about 50% that connected with driving and a sixth of that connected with simply with living.</p>
<p>Disappointingly, the precise methods Exponent used are proprietary, and the total report is not available to the public, but rest assured that this isn&#8217;t a fly-by-night cyclists&#8217; advocacy organization that is cooking the numbers. As Exponent reasons on its website, it has been relied on to consider high-profile misfortunes such as the sabotage of the federal building in Oklahoma City.</p>
<p>So, for the effect of argument, let’s assume that Exponents analysis is an underestimation and debate another detailed study that measures the risks using a minutely different yardstick—the number of kills per billions of kilometres travelled rather than per hour of activity. Rutgers University researchers who actioned this study concluded that, per kilometre travelled, cycling kills are eleven times as high as car occupant fatalities. Looks rather grim for cycling until you examine what the same study discovered about walking. Walking kills per kilometre walked were 36 times as high as driving fatalities, implying that walking is more than 3 times as risky as pedalling.</p>
<p>However, there is still more that riders could do to take responsibility for our protection. A disturbing 24 percent of deadly bike accidents involve an drunken cyclist. Research shows that cyclists get into many smaller accidents that could be prevented. Various studies have shown that the failure to wear lights in the dark or a helmet hugely increases a biker’s risk. Finally, riders starting out must be really careful about cars opening doors and making turns, and about pedalling on the sidewalks.</p>
<p>The bottom line: Its not that cycling doesn&#8217;t have risk, but some consideration is in order, more so when you begin to factor in the many health advantages that cycling provides.</p>
<p>2. Its too far. The ride may well take too long or take too much out of you if you live further than, say, 10 miles from work. But consider ways to expand your potential distance. Many commuters, for example, use foldable bikes so they can go half way on a morning train.</p>
<p>3. Bikes are expensive. Not true. You should be able to buy a new or used bike perfect for simple commuting for less than $500. Find a great, close bike shop with a knowledgeable staff, discuss the route and length of commute you&#8217;re thinking of, and they&#8217;ll help you select the proper frame and number of gears you&#8217;ll need. </p>
<p>If you&#8217;re just beginning, you may want to search for a functional, commuter bicycle that has fenders to save your clothes, a kickstand, and a comfy saddle. And, if you&#8217;re really looking for a comfortable ride, take a gander at the new class of coasting bikes that are designed to reconnect people with worry free recollections of cycling as a child. They have pedal brakes called coaster brakes instead of hand brakes and an automatic shifter, and while they are not designed for quickness, they&#8217;re a great way to get back into the saddle, says Doyne.</p>
<p>4. Its not possible to transport the kit I require. If this is what you think, you are toting far more than the normal person to work or you do not own the proper bag or features on your bicycle. A sturdy basket or touring panniers will mean you can easily carry a computer, spares clothes, snacks, a few books, a handful of folders, and whatever other gadgets you usually take with you. </p>
<p>5. There isn&#8217;t anywhere to scrub up. Jeff Peel of the League of American Bicyclists states that lots cyclists do worry over this, but that there are many other solutions beyond simply showing up at work stinky and sweaty. First, check to ensure that your office doesn&#8217;t have a full bathrooms somewhere. If it doesn’t, check nearby gyms or fitness clubs. They often offer shower-only memberships for bike or running types. </p>
<p>6. Cycling will turn me sterile. This is an accusation that has circulated since the late 1990s, and there&#8217;s a tiny amount of fact to it. There is studies that serious bicycle riders can suffer temporary and even long-lasting problems if they log many hours on a racing saddle that isn&#8217;t fitted well. But there are now plenty of seats with ergonomically designed cutaway grooves that take the pressure off the key blood vessels and nerves. As long as your saddle fits properly and you don&#8217;t ride as much as a professional rider training for the Tour de France, cycling is much more apt to reduce your odds of erectile dysfunction than increase them, since cycling will assist keep cardiovascular disease a large cause of erectile dysfunction.</p>

<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><p>Spaniard <strong>Joaquím Rodríguez</strong> will have the opportunity to race the Tour de France for the first time in his career next season. He met with his new team, <strong>Katusha</strong>, last week to discuss his 2010 schedule.</p>
<p>&#8220;It will be like a dream to be at the start,&#8221; said Rodríguez in a press release. &#8220;I intend to approach it as I did the 2008 Giro: calmly and looking for a stage win.&#8221;</p>
<p>Rodríguez finished 17th overall at the 2008 Giro d&#8217;Italia and placed third on two stages.</p>
<p>Last month, Tour organiser Amaury Sports Organisation (ASO) presented the <a href="http://www.cyclingnews.com/races/97th-tour-de-france-gt">2010 Tour de France route</a>. It starts in Rotterdam, Netherlands, on July 3 and will end in Paris on July 25. Its first mountains come in the Alps, at Morzine and Saint-Jean-de-Maurienne. Four Pyrenean mountain stages will feature in the race&#8217;s final week, with a stage to the Col du Tourmalet only four days before the finish in Paris.</p>
<p>Rodríguez also planned his first half of the season leading up to the Tour de France. He will start at the <em>Volta a Mallorca</em> in February and then race the <em>Volta ao Algarve</em> and <em>Tirreno-Adriatico</em>. At the Tirreno-Adriatico, he will target the stage he has won the last two years in a row, to Montelupone.</p>
<p>He will then race Spain&#8217;s <em>Volta a Catalunya</em> and <em>País Vasco</em> prior the Ardennes Classics in April.</p>
<p>&#8220;<em>Amstel Gold</em>, <em>Flèche Wallonne</em> and <em>Liège-Bastogne-Liège </em>will be the season&#8217;s highlights for me,&#8221; Rodríguez continued.</p>
<p>He finished second in Liège-Bastogne-Liège this year and has helped his former-Caisse d&#8217;Epargne teammate Alejandro Valverde win the event twice. Last season, he finished eighth in all three Ardennes Classics.</p>
<p>After the Classics, he will race the Tour de Luxembourg and Tour de Suisse. He plans to lead Katusha on the mountain stages at the Tour de Suisse, his last preparation race prior to the Tour de France.</p>
<p>Rodríguez ended four years with Caisse d&#8217;Epargne at the Japan Cup last month. He signed a contract earlier this year to join Russian team Katusha for 2010.</p>

<p><strong><em>I wrote this article some time ago &#8211; but it is always important information to keep in mind when working with first-time riders&#8230;</em></strong></p>
<p>Many people know that I have had horses for years. And like me, I&#8217;m sure you get frequent requests from people who want to ride your horses. Does this sound familiar? &#8220;My children love horses, they have always wanted to ride a pony!&#8221; Or, &#8220;I used to ride horses (at summer camp), I know all about them, could I ride yours some time?&#8221; The automatic answer is &#8220;Sure, just let me know when!&#8221; But afterward, we realize that this is not just a &#8220;ride&#8221;.</p>
<p><strong> </strong><strong><em>Tip 1</em>: Any first-time rider should have instruction before they take their first ride.</strong> This takes extra time on your part, but it is a very necessary step. If not, it could be dangerous for them, as well as you.</p>
<p>I talk to numerous people, and many times the subject of horses comes up. About 90% of one-time riders tell me the same story. &#8220;Yes, I rode a horse, got bucked off and that was the last time I will ever get near a horse.&#8221; The accounts amaze me; horse bites, riding run-away horses, saddles that fall off, getting kicked, and all because the horse owner did not give any instruction beforehand. I try to explain that if they would have known a few simple things before they got on the horse, they truly could have had a wonderful experience. Most people shrug and say &#8221;never again.&#8221; With a little instruction, we can help put a stop to these incidents and make first time rides safe and enjoyable.</p>
<p><strong>Before a rider ever gets near the horse, we need to explain some key points. Riders of any age should know that you will be assisting them, and they must listen to what you tell them for their safety.</strong></p>
<p>One of the first steps we can take to help ensure a great experience is with attire.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 2:</em> Proper helmets should be worn, as well as a protective boot or heavy shoe with a heel.</strong> Flat-soled shoes increase the risk of the foot slipping through a stirrup and getting caught-up.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 3:</em> If you have protective vests, use them also.</strong></p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 4:</em> During the warmer months, let parents know that long pants are the best attire.</strong> Although shorts may keep their child cooler, a pair of jeans will be much more comfortable than a child&#8217;s bare legs rubbing against the leather of a saddle.</p>
<p>Some other basic instructions should include:<br />
<strong><em> </em></strong></p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 5:</em>  How to touch the horse by gently petting, not patting, with easy movements. Explain that horses can spook with fast movements.</strong></p>
<p><strong> </strong><br />
<strong><em>Tip 6:</em>  Voices need to be kept at indoor levels for smaller children, not outside voices.</strong></p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 7:</em>  Explain how to walk around a horse at least 2 arm-lengths away from the horse&#8217;s haunches and tail.</strong> If younger children are involved, walk with them explaining how far this distance is.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 8:</em>  Talk about walking around the front of the horse, touching him as you go, and talking to the horse.</strong></p>
<p><strong> </strong><br />
<strong><em>Tip 9:</em>  Small hands, as well as adult hands, automatically reach to the horse&#8217;s head and mouth. Show new riders how to hold their hands.</strong> If you allow people to feed your horses treats, show your guest how to hold their hand flat and feed with their palm instead of their fingers.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 10:</em>  Explain that you stand on the left side of the horse to hold, lead and saddle-up<em>.</em></strong></p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 11:</em> Show how to lead properly by having slack in the lead rope and allowing the horse to carry his head at a natural level.</strong><br />
<strong><em> </em></strong></p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 12:</em>  The lead rope should NEVER be wrapped around a hand or arm.</strong> If smaller children have a hard time with a long lead rope, find them a shorter one or help them hold the horse.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 13: .</em> Demonstrate how to brush the horse, with a curry-comb first and a brush second.</strong> Show them how to follow the direction of the horse&#8217;s hair. Also, explain the &#8220;ticklish spots&#8221; and areas where gentle brushing needs to be done.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 14:</em> New riders should never ride a horse that is not a calm packer</strong>. If older (or younger) riders ask to ride a horse because they like the way it looks, but the horse is too spirited, tell them &#8220;no&#8221;. It is better to have a bit of disappointment than the consequence of an accident.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 15:</em> Once you have groomed and saddled the horse, be sure to use a lead rope or a lounge line with the horse<em>.</em></strong> The best scenario would be to have a small paddock or round pen to ride in, in addition to using the lead rope or lounge line. This will give the new rider a sense of security, helping them to relax.</p>
<p>Don&#8217;t forget how it feels to ride for the very first time. It seems very high from the ground, unbalanced, almost like you could fall. It feels like you&#8217;ve lost control, and there isn&#8217;t much to hang on to! Take these thoughts into consideration and you&#8217;ll realize that a short, well-guided ride is better than a long, unsupervised experience.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 16:</em> Due to liability issues, be sure your insurance will cover any mishaps<em>.</em></strong> It is an issue that most of us feel will never come up, but many accidents can turn into more than ever expected.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ip17:</em> Be sure all young riders under 18 have parents present with consent to let their child ride<em>.</em></strong> Be sure all older riders understand that accidents can happen, and they are not going to hold you liable.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 18:</em> Contact your insurance company, the experts in this area, and get their advice before you let friends ride.</strong> It&#8217;s worth it.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 19:</em> Additionally, check the equine liability laws in your state.</strong> Some states require that signs be posted throughout a facility, while others require signed waivers. Some require both. Make sure that you follow whatever your state requires so that you, your horses and all riders and spectators are protected.</p>
<p><strong><em>Tip 20: </em>Give the gift of kindness when you think about allowing someone to ride your horses.</strong> Be sure it&#8217;s a safe, informative, and fun experience. After all, we all have our passion because we truly enjoyed a horse ride-way back when. Pass it on!</p>

<p>We went downtown, yesterday, to see the new Gold Line light rail line extension and to ride it into east L.A.</p>
<p>I was with my mother, who walks with difficulty after her hip operation last year.  </p>
<p>We parked somewhere east of Little Tokyo, where art and commerce are slowly converting old factories into sunny communes of post-industrialism.</p>
<p>Along Alameda,  a band played and friendly crowds stood along the light rail track waiting to board trains that ran to Pasadena (Northbound) or Atlantic Avenue (Southbound).  Many yellow shirted Metro employees handed out brochures, maps and smiles answering any questions from excited and bewildered riders.</p>
<p>This is still new for Los Angeles, the idea that human beings might ride on trains to travel around this city. In Prague, Paris, Tokyo, Kuala Lumpur, Mumbai, Buenos Aires, Montreal, Vancouver and Boston people crowd unselfconsciously into those steel boxes on steel tracks, but here in a city that was last progressive 60 years ago, the light rail was ripped out along with our civic engagement.</p>
<p>______________________________________________________________</p>
<p>I had driven down the 405, yesterday, from Van Nuys to Marina Del Rey. The sun was brilliant, the air was cool, the wind was blowing, and I have lived here long enough to feel uneasy in these ideal conditions.  </p>
<p>Somewhere in the left lane, near the Getty Center, I was traveling about 60 MPH in fairly heavy traffic, moving along.  A BMW sped up behind me. I looked in the mirror and could see an impatient face on a young male driver. I pulled out of his lane and moved to the far right. </p>
<p>In the far right lane, I found space and accelerated. The BMW also pulled into my lane, behind me and began to tailgate me. I went into another lane, and he did too.</p>
<p>I was going 80 as I passed the 10 off-ramp,  and he was right behind me. As I turned to go west on the Marina Freeway, he pulled up on my right, slamming his foot down on the accelerator and tore up the road to pass me fading fast into the 405 South.</p>
<p>Where did his aggression come from? I had moved out of his way. I gave him his road.  I tried to escape.</p>
<p>But that was not enough. He was in the mood for a race, and overcome with the urge to beat me and to alpha guy fuck off another male driver. </p>
<p>__________________________________________________________________</p>
<p>On the train, my mom and I met a young woman who told us to disembark at Mariachi Plaza in Boyle Heights where there was a street fair, with entertainment, food and other events.</p>
<p>One emerges from the underground into the unfiltered, concrete-baked sunlight of east LA. </p>
<p>A stained glass canopy covers the escalators. This is a cathedral of light, an ecclesiastical structure imbued with a Catholic message for this old Mexican-American neighborhood.   Rays of gold, red, blue and green pour through the roof and illuminate riders as they pass through Mariachi Plaza.  In an age where every new building in Los Angeles is stripped of meaning and constructed so obtusely and abstractly, this Metro station gently merges church and train.</p>
<p>We spent a little time walking around and ate some ceviche and stood next to the <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Lucha_Reyes_%28Mexican_singer%29">Lucha Reyes</a> statue.</p>
<p>Then we got back in a long, outdoor line to wait for the train.  As we waited there, an older woman walked up to us. She said she had lived in Boyle Heights her whole life, but was going to ride the train two stops to downtown.  She was scared and wanted us to accompany her.</p>
<p>Her name was Rosalie, and she asked us if we were Jewish. I said yes, and she said, “the activist traditions of Boyle Heights came from the Jewish people”. She was 75-years-old and remembered the community when there were Jews living in it.</p>
<p>As we went down into the station, she panicked. “Maybe I shouldn’t ride the train,” she said. Over and over she asked how she would find her way back to Mariachi Plaza. I told her that many employees were around and she would not get lost. She was afraid of disorientation, suffocation, crowds, and unfamiliar surroundings.</p>
<p>“Your son is so sweet,” she told my mom.  What Rosalie didn’t know is that I have had panic attacks. And, like Rosalie, one of my fears is claustrophobia and the other is getting lost. Her irrational worries were perfectly sane to me.</p>
<p>On the station platform, more old people introduced themselves. A gregarious man from Panorama City said he was born and raised in Chicago, and had graduated from Von Steuben High School in 1955, a few years after my mother.  </p>
<p>The train pulled up, we all stuffed ourselves in. Rosalie was smiling, happy, laughing. She had found friends in strangers just by talking, riding and moving on light rail.</p>
<p>We got off at Little Tokyo. Rosalie shook our hands and crossed to the other side of the platform where she met some other people who were going back to East LA. </p>
<p>One afternoon, in the new Los Angeles, where a normal urban venture suddenly opens up a new avenue of hope. </p>
